Aaron Martens - Guntersville, AL - Largemouth

Our guy this week could not miss in 2015! Bassmaster Angler of the year, Aaron Martens is on a roll like no other. We caught up with the Furious Hawg Snatcher to flip the hallowed grass of Lake Guntersville. You don't wanna miss this one.
